Stunning old country pub tucked away in the countryside--everything you'd expect a quality English pub to be--warm and cozy; friendly, welcoming staff; sleepy doggos tucked under bar stools; great beer; and spectacular food. Came here for a Sunday roast with a dear friend and had an *amazing* roast dinner. She chose the lamb, I had the pork belly with crackling. Heaping portions of food--thick, juicy slices of perfectly cooked meat, roast potatoes, no less than four other vegetables, Yorkshires, gravy, the lot! Absolutely delicious. Cleaned our plates and were hankering for some crumble and custard, which sadly wasn't on the menu that day, but had a lovely raspberry and almond frangipane instead. Attentive but not intrusive service, good value for money. Can't wait to come back!
